
This typically Ligurian village is situated on a hill top, some 3km north of the seaside resort San Lorenzo al Mare. The village is known for its beautifully renovated houses, featuring the classic natural stone fronts. The village has a small food shop for all daily needs whereas the neighbouring village Cipressa (1.5km away) has a bar, a newsagent, a pharmacy, a food shop and a good restaurant offering typically local cuisine.
The nearest nice beaches are in San Stefano al Mare, Riva Ligure or Arma di Taggia. Sanremo and Imperia are close enough, to visit for an evening stroll.
Costarainera is a good place from where to explore the Ligurian hinterland with its pretty villages Molini di Triora and Montalto Ligure or visit the towns of Genova (100km) or the French Riviera (80km).
